Prevention Tips: Best practices to avoid mold growth on stored mushrooms
Mold thrives in damp, dark environments, making mushrooms particularly susceptible during storage. To prevent mold growth, start by understanding the enemy: moisture. Mushrooms are naturally high in water content, and even slight increases in humidity can create ideal conditions for mold spores to flourish. The key to successful mushroom storage lies in controlling this moisture while maintaining their delicate texture and flavor.
Step 1: Choose the Right Storage Method
Opt for paper bags or breathable containers instead of airtight plastic bags. Paper allows air circulation, reducing condensation buildup. If using plastic, perforate the bag with small holes to mimic breathability. For longer storage, consider refrigeration, but avoid washing mushrooms beforehand—moisture accelerates mold. If you must clean them, pat dry thoroughly with a paper towel before storing.
Step 2: Control Temperature and Humidity
Store mushrooms in the refrigerator’s crisper drawer, where humidity is slightly higher than the rest of the fridge but still controlled. Aim for a temperature between 35°F and 40°F (2°C and 4°C). For those without a crisper, place a damp paper towel in a container with the mushrooms, ensuring it’s not soaking wet. This balances humidity without oversaturating the environment.
Step 3: Monitor and Rotate Stock
Regularly inspect stored mushrooms for early signs of mold, such as discoloration or a fuzzy texture. Remove any affected pieces immediately to prevent spores from spreading. Practice FIFO (First In, First Out) by using older mushrooms first. Fresh mushrooms typically last 5–7 days in the fridge, but this can vary based on initial freshness and storage conditions.

Signs of Spoilage: Key indicators that mushrooms are beyond salvage and must be discarded
Mold on mushrooms is a clear sign of spoilage, but not all moldy mushrooms are created equal. Some may have superficial mold that can be trimmed away, while others are beyond rescue. The key lies in recognizing the signs that indicate a mushroom has crossed the threshold from salvageable to discardable. One critical indicator is the extent of mold growth. If the mold is confined to a small area and the mushroom feels firm, you might be able to cut away the affected part and use the rest. However, if the mold has spread extensively, covering large portions or penetrating deeply into the mushroom, it’s a red flag. Mold spores can infiltrate the mushroom’s structure, making it unsafe to consume even after trimming.
Another telltale sign is a change in texture. Fresh mushrooms should feel plump and slightly spongy. If they become slimy, mushy, or unusually soft, it’s a sign of bacterial decay, often accompanied by mold. This texture change indicates that the mushroom’s cell structure has broken down, allowing harmful microorganisms to thrive. At this stage, salvaging is not an option, as the mushroom’s integrity is compromised. Similarly, a strong, unpleasant odor—often described as ammonia-like or sour—signals advanced spoilage. While fresh mushrooms have a mild, earthy scent, a foul smell is a definitive warning that they should be discarded immediately.
Color changes also play a crucial role in determining spoilage. While some discoloration, like slight browning, may be harmless, dark spots or patches that feel wet or sticky are cause for concern. These areas often indicate mold growth or enzymatic breakdown. If the gills of a mushroom turn dark and slimy, it’s a sign that the mushroom is no longer safe to eat. For shiitake or oyster mushrooms, which naturally have darker colors, look for unusual hues or textures that deviate from their typical appearance.
Finally, consider the storage conditions and age of the mushrooms. Fresh mushrooms typically last 5–7 days in the refrigerator, but this timeframe can shorten if they’re stored improperly. If you notice any of the above signs within this period, it’s safer to discard them. For dried mushrooms, mold is less common but still possible, especially if they’ve been exposed to moisture. Always inspect dried mushrooms for white, fuzzy patches or an off smell before rehydrating. When in doubt, err on the side of caution—consuming spoiled mushrooms can lead to foodborne illnesses, which far outweigh the inconvenience of discarding them.
